AnnotationIncipit: In vigilia Pasche. Single leaf from the Egmond Breviary (New York, Pierpont Morgan Library : ms. 87). The Egmond Breviary was commissioned by a duke of Guelders-Jülich (based on the coats of arms), probably Arnold van Egmond, and was produced in Utrecht.
